A Fondness for Quirky Teenagers
Charlie Bartlett is the movie no studio wanted to make. Impressed by his second unit directing work on Meet the Fockers, executives at Universal encouraged longtime editor Jon Poll – whose editing credits include Meet the Parents and the last two Austin Powers movies – to bring them a movie that he could direct. When he did, it was for a teen comedy in which the titular character sets himself up as the unofficial school therapist, who listens to his fellow students problems and doles out scammed prescription drugs. Universal passed. So did every studio in Hollywood. "No one would make this film," Poll tells FilmStew during a recent interview in San Francisco. “It's an R-rated movie where kids are giving each other drugs." To Poll, that was an overly simplistic read of a dark comedy that he nevertheless considers heartwarming and optimistic.

IDS Scheer Announces Support for OASIS Reference Model with ARIS SOA ...
BERWYN, Pa. - (Business Wire) IDS Scheer, the leading provider of business process management, today announced support for the OASIS SOA Reference Model used in tandem with ARIS SOA Architect. The structure and management of a business process-oriented service landscape requires close cooperation between specialized departments and IT within companies. IDS Scheer has leveraged its expanded methodology for Business-Driven SOA into developing comprehensive support for describing, planning and managing services — designed specifically for this type of collaboration within an organization. The new methodology, based on the OASIS SOA Reference Model, categorizes services using business criteria with a concentration on those with the greatest strategic importance – the end result is mitigation of risks within SOA projects.
Arroyo critics welcome Melo's appointment
Critics of President Arroyo on Saturday welcomed the appointment of retired Supreme Court associate justice Jose Melo as the new chairman of the Commission on Elections (COMELEC). Sen. Manuel Roxas II said he is confident that Melo "will uphold the same courage and professionalism when he issued the report on extrajudicial killings." In 2006, Melo headed a fact-finding body created by President Arroyo known as the Melo Commission to investigate the cases of extrajudicial and political killings in the country. Roxas noted that Melo's appointment was the result of "fruitful conversations" between the Arroyo administration and civil society groups. He said he believes that Melo will implement reforms in the controversy-ridden COMELEC as well as play a key role in preparing for peaceful, honest and clean elections in 2010.
MOTU previews upcoming Digital Performer 6 release
In the resulting comp take, crossfades can be applied, along with all standard operations for editing audio regions in a DP track. Users can then use the resulting comp track as yet another take itself, which allows users to “comp the comp" by incorporating any portion of an existing comp take into a new comp take. Additional features include ProVerb, a processor-efficient convolution reverb plug-in that delivers the acoustic spatial sounds to any track or mix. A Dynamic Mix feature automatically “ducks" the wet signal as the dry input signal rises, then raises the wet mix as the dry signal level subsides. MasterWorks Leveler is an accurate model of the legendary Teletronix LA-2A optical leveling amplifier, known for its Automatic Gain Control (AGC) characteristics. The Digital Performer engineering team works closely with Apple engineering on a on-going basis to continue improving Digital Performer on the Mac as an advanced platform for music and audio production.
